2009 EEAO/NAAEE Auction and Awards Gala


The Environmental Education Association of Oregon (EEAO) is proud to co-host the Power of Partnerships auction and awards gala on October 9, 2009 from 6-10pm in Portland, Oregon at the Oregon Museum of Science and Industry.  This event will be held in conjunction with the annual North American Association for Environmental Education (NAAEE) conference in Portland from October 7-11, 2009.  Environmental educators, business and community leaders, and partners from all over Oregon and the nation will come together to enjoy delicious food and beverages, engaging exhibits in the museum and a live and silent auction that showcases fine Oregon products and services.

A primary mission of EEAO is to advance the role of environmental education in helping students achieve educational success.  Environmental education fosters learning for change that is essential to the transformation in our thinking, decision-making, and daily living.  So many decisions for the future depend on our collective ability to apply an integral approach to our teaching such that students are able to understand the interrelated elements of sustainable systems; from ecological, economical, and community perspectives.
